Cobb County 2040 Comprehensive Plan Draft Available to Review

The State of Georgia requires local governments to maintain their plans to accurately reflect current community conditions and the community’s goals and priorities for the future.  Maintenance of the plan includes plan amendments and regular updates.

The current Cobb County 2040 Comprehensive Plan was adopted in 2017. There has since been three land-use plan amendments in 2018, 2019, and 2020. Regular updates are required every 5-years in accordance with the Qualified Local Government (QLG) recertification schedule maintained by the State of Georgia Department of Community Affairs (DCA). In order to maintain Qualified Local Government status and to continue to promote a healthy and economically vibrant county, staff along with help from Cobb’s citizens will be launching a five-year update to the 2040 Comprehensive Plan in 2022.

The focus of this 5-year update will be limited in scope to the 5-year update elements as required by the DCA minimum standards and procedures. This update will culminate with the re-adoption of the 2040 plan with updates to the following:

  • Existing needs and opportunities,
  • Land use,
  • Community work program;
  • Transportation*; and
  • A new broadband services element.

*The transportation element is included by reference to ensure the plan includes the applicable needs, goals, and work program items from the most up-to-date Comprehensive Transportation Plan: CobbForward.
